A poem about a beginner artist.
Her face is contorted in a funny way

Her tongue is sticking out
Her eyebrow is raised
Her nose is all scrunched up

Her fingers hold the brush fiercely
Her eyes move from me to her canvas

I blink
She yells, "Don't move!"

I sniffle
She yells, "Don't move!"

I twitch
She yells, "Don't move!"

I laugh
She yells, "Don't move!"

Her tongue goes back into her mouth
Her eyebrow goes down
Her nose un-scrunches itself

And she's done

She flips the canvas
And although it looks nothing like me
It's amazing all the same
